发明名称 ULTRASONIC MOTOR
摘要 <P>PROBLEM TO BE SOLVED: To suppress deterioration in drive performance in a self-sensing type ultrasonic motor which enables detection of the rotational position and the rotational speed of a movable body without using a sensor such as an encoder. <P>SOLUTION: An oscillating object (stator) drives the movable body (rotor) through the vibration of a piezoelectric element 12a, and detects the rotational position of the movable object by an output change from a detection electrode IS, occurring when a contact part of the oscillating object passes in the groove formed in the movable object. In this case, an amplitude detecting part 28 detects an output amplitude from the detection electrode IS, and a deviation calculating part 29 calculates a deviation with regard to an ideal amplitude value (the amplitude value of the optimum drive), and a control unit 24 changes the oscillation frequency of a drive voltage generating part 25 corresponding to the calculated result. Accordingly, the control unit vibrates the drive voltage generating part at a normal resonance frequency when the contact portion passes on a normal area without the groove, and the control unit lowers the oscillation frequency when the contact portion passes in the detection area with the groove to be matched with the resonance frequency, thereby suppressing the deterioration in the drive performance (torque). A position detecting part 30 detects the rotational position by a change in the drive frequency. <P>COPYRIGHT: (C)2010,JPO&INPIT
